The role involves supporting a Gentleman in his 30's who is very sociable, active and enjoys going out many times through the day such as trampolining and swimming (2:1) and going for a Toby Carvery. He enjoys walks in his wheelchair and outings in his car - so you must be prepared enjoy going out in all weathers! He likes lots of sensory stimulation when at home so enjoys listening to nursery rhymes and playing with sensory toys.
He has epilepsy and profound learning disabilities. He is partially sighted, so needs support with all aspects of his life such as personal care, preparing meals, doing activities and that his home is kept clean and tidy, which will be an essential task.
Due to being unable to communicate verbally and needing lots of sensory stimulation, he can express self-injurious behaviour when bored or being unable to go out when he would like to.
He has a lot of family who are involved and it is important for him that staff keep his family updated regularly with how he is.
